Original U.S. WWII D-Day POW KIA 307th Airborne Engineer Battalion Named Service Coat Category_Fusee Spring & Cover The second version model 1870sOriginal Item: One of a kind. Private Robert K. Hause (ASN: 13027360) enlisted on April 1st, 1941 in Philadelphia. He served with B Company, 307th Airborne Engineer Battalion, 82nd Airborne Division when he jumped into Normandy on D Day.
